Abstract

A small electric light bulb (10) is mounted into a holder (7) that fits into an aperture formed in a circuit board (PCB) (1). The PCB has a hole formed with an essentially circular cross- section and with two oppositely positioned slots that allow locking arms to be inserted. The main body (9) of the holder has a pair of arms (13) with tip sections (15) that latch into position. Contact arms (12) engage tracks on the PCB.

With such sockets to be arranged on printed circuit boards Different fastening mechanisms are already known. For example, a plug-in or locking mechanism, by means of which the lamps by simply clipping into the corresponding PCB opening on the side, on which usually other components are assembled be this clipping in, since it's just a linear Movement acts, simply by means of an automatic placement machine can be done. As a result of this snap fastening however, the lamp can only be removed from the side on which it was used, which leads to the fact that the Lamp often removed the entire circuit board from the device and only then can the retrofit take place. Another one The lamps are partially driven by the mechanism PCB opening inserted and by a rotary movement attached to the plate, which is why a machine assembly is difficult, but cumbersome to assemble by hand must become. Here too there is the disadvantage that Replacing the lamp if it is fitted on the component side is again necessary to remove the circuit board is. If the lamp is attached to the opposite side of the plate, this means that there is usually no need to remove a printed circuit board, however, this assembly has one on the opposite side very cumbersome initial assembly with a separate operation result.

Claims (17)

  1. Holder for a small incandescent lamp for detachable and fixable insertion into an aperture (2), which is adapted to the holder (7) and is provided with peripheral widenings, in a printed circuit (1) and contacting of the lamp (10) by pressing of the lamp connecting wires (6, 26) guided on contact arms (12, 27) against the strip conductors (5) of the printed circuit (1), wherein for insertion and fixing of the holder a clamping rotation mechanism is provided, an insertion locking mechanism additionally being provided on the holder (7), by means of which locking mechanism the holder is insertable so as to be held from one side of the printed circuit (1), wherein resilient locking arms (13, 28) formed on the holder (7), upon reaching of the final insertion position, snap into a locked position with simultaneous abutment of the locking arms (13, 28), due to the contact arms (12, 27) which are axially resilient parallel to the holder longitudinal axis, against the other side of the printed circuit (1), and wherein the holder (7), upon actuation of the rotation mechanism, is insertable from the other side of the printed circuit, the holder (7) being held in the final insertion position by the locking arms (13, 28) not passing through the printed circuit aperture during insertion and rotation and the resilient contact arms (12, 27) abutting the same, so that the holder is insertable and removable with respectively the same lamp orientation from both sides.
  2. Holder according to claim 1, characterised in that the locking arms (13, 28) are formed on the holder (7) so as to be diametrically opposite, spaced from the contact arms (12, 27) and so as to extend substantially congruently and engage under the edge of the aperture (2) at correspondingly narrowed places (4).
  3. Holder according to claim 1 or 2, characterised in that in order to define the insertion movement before rotation in the frame of the rotation mechanism, lobes (17) are formed on the holder (7) diametrically opposite one another and with clearance from the contact arms (12, 27) and offset, and after passing of the contact arms (12, 27) through the peripheral widenings (3) of the aperture (2) upon reaching the rotated position act on the printed circuit (1).
  4. Holder according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the holder (7) has a substantially hollow cylindrical form and the resilient locking arms (13) provided with locking projections (15, 16) are formed by cut-outs in the cylinder wall.
  5. Holder according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the locking arms (13) provided with locking projections (15, 16) are formed of flanges (14) angled by bending through substantially 180° and extending substantially parallel to the holder wall.
  6. Holder according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the locking arms provided with locking projections are formed as metal arms to be mounted on the holder in seats formed thereon.
  7. Holder according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the contact arms are formed as metal contact springs to be mounted on the holder in seats formed thereon.
  8. Holder according to claim 6 and 7, characterised in that a respective metal locking arm (28) and a metal contact arm (27) are so connected together that strip conductors disposed on either side of the printed circuit are contactable on one side by the contact arm (27) and on the other side by the locking arm (28).
  9. Holder according to claim 8, characterised in that the locking arm (28) and the contact arm (27) are formed as a one-piece contact spring (23) which is mounted in a seat (25) on the holder.
  10. Holder according to one of claims 3 to 9, characterised by notches (18) formed in the holder (7), in which the lobes (17) are disposed, set inward.
  11. Holder according to one of claims 3 to 10, characterised in that the lobes (17) are so arranged that they extend substantially congruently with the widenings (3) in the contact position of the holder (7).
  12. Holder according to one of claims 3 to 11, characterised in that the angle of rotation (α) is 30° to 40°, preferably 35°.
  13. Holder according to one of the preceding claims, characterised by a locking lug (21) formed on the holder (7), which engages in a peripheral convexity (8) of the aperture (2) in the contact position.
  14. Holder according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that each laterally projecting contact arm (12) is provided with a clamping groove (19) of smaller diameter than the diameter of the lamp connecting wire (6), which receives the lamp connecting wire (6).
  15. Holder according to one of the preceding claims, characterised by an insertion slope (22, 31) formed on the contact arm (12, 27).
  16. Holder according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the region of the holder (7) which receives the incandescent lamp (10) preferably in a lying position is formed as a reflector (11).
  17. Holder according to one of the preceding claims, characterised in that the holder (7) is formed in one piece, in particular from plastics material.
